    I had a Toshiba 32" tv model CX32E60 I bought in 1997, and kept until I went flat-panel LCD at the end of 2006. I loved that tv..

    Good tv's, BUT, their power supplies are real sensitive to bad power coming in. IF you get this tv, I highly suggest you have it running from a good UPS. I ran mine once from a generator that put out crappy power, and it nuked the power supply.

    Now, I'm an electronic tech, and was able to fix it by replacing the bad IC chip, and a couple diodes, BUT, it stayed unstable from then on, and I had to mount a pc fan in there, to keep that chip COLD. If not, it would overheat, and fry nearly instantly. Over 7 years of continuing to use the tv once that happened, I had to replace the ic chip another 2-3 times, and the diodes about 4 times to keep it running.

    If you aren't a tech, and can't fix it, you can't afford to pay anybody to do it for you....
